在当前的数字货币世界中,以太坊(Ethereum)作为一种主流的区块链平台,其钱包的设置对于区块链用户至关重要。币...
在数字货币崛起的时代,以太坊(Ethereum)作为一种最具创新性和技术魅力的区块链平台,吸引了大量的开发人员和投资者。使用以太坊,用户需要一个安全可靠的钱包来存储他们的资产,其中Keystore是以太坊钱包的一种重要形式。本文将详细介绍以太坊钱包的Keystore,包括其定义、使用方法、优缺点、安全性和最佳实践等内容,以及用户经常提出的一些相关问题。
以太坊钱包的Keystore,又称为“密钥存储文件”,是一种用于存储以太坊私钥的文件格式。Keystore文件是加密的,因此能够为用户的数字资产提供一定程度的安全性。在以太坊生态系统中,用户的资产是由其私钥控制的,而这关键字由Keystore文件安全存储。用户可以通过密码对Keystore文件进行解密,从而访问自己的以太坊地址及其中的资产。
创建以太坊钱包Keystore的过程相对简单。用户可以通过多种以太坊钱包软件(如MetaMask、Mist等)来生成Keystore文件。以下是简要步骤:
用户可以使用Keystore文件来访问他们的以太坊钱包。只需在相应的应用中,选择导入钱包,上传Keystore文件并输入初始设置时设置的密码,即可解锁wallet。
与其他形式的钱包(如硬件钱包、纸钱包等)相比,以太坊的Keystore文件同样有其独特的优缺点:
安全性是加密货币钱包的重中之重,Keystore文件虽然加密、便利,但还是存在潜在的安全隐患。以下是对其安全性的评估:
用户将密钥存储与其他安全措施结合使用,有助于最大程度地降低潜在攻击的风险,确保数字资产的安全。
为了安全、高效的使用以太坊钱包的Keystore,用户应遵循一些最佳实践:
如果用户不小心丢失了Keystore文件,但是还有保留了对应的自定义密码,那么可以方便地通过恢复钱包。相反,如果用户同时遗忘了密码,则无法恢复钱包。建议用户对Keystore进行合理备份,比如通过云存储或者硬盘存储等方式保存多个副本。
Keystore文件在用户设置的密码保护下生成,安全性相对较高,但如果密码过于简单,仍然存在被黑客猜解的风险。用户应使用强密码以及附加的安全措施,比如双重认证,以增强其安全性。
用户可以使用以太坊钱包软件来验证Keystore文件的完整性。通常在导入Keystore文件时,软件会检查文件的格式是否正确,并提示用户输入保护密码。如果系统反馈错误,用户需要核实文件是否被篡改或损坏。
最常见的Keystore文件格式为JSON格式。在以太坊生态中,很多钱包应用都使用这种格式存储密钥信息。某些钱包可能会有各自的特定格式,但大部分都基于这种JSON格式。
Keystore适合那些有一定计算机基础的人群,特别是那些进行小额投资和交易的用户。由于Keystore的便利性和可移植性,使其成为了不少普通投资者的选择,但对于大额资金持有者,建议使用硬件钱包进行更为安全的离线存储。
综上所述,以太坊钱包的Keystore为用户提供了一种安全便捷的密钥存储方式。用户在使用过程中需注意安全,并对Keystore文件进行合理的备份与保护,确保数字资产的安全。通过对相关问题的详细解答,我们希望能够为用户提供更好的理解与使用方向。